Some of the effects of GTP on human fat cell adenylate cyclase activity were studied. This nucleotide caused a dose-dependent inhibition of basal activity without affecting the hormone-activated rate of cAMP formation. Maximal effects were observed at GTP-concentrations of about 1 x 10(-4) M. The relative extent of hormonal stimulation was about 1.5-fold increased in the presence of 0.1 mM GTP.
